Default ABS Warning Light

Don't try and guess what caused the ABS and T/C light to come on, it can be many things all of which can only be diag. by a scanner. This can happen when your brakes run hot and fade, dirty brake fluid, bad sensors, bad connections up to a bad modulator assembly.
How long has it been since you had your brake fluid changed?? Good place to start, fast and cheap and will clean out stuck valves in the control unit.
